**Vendor note: Inkmill markdown pipeline**

Rendering for Parchway docs is outsourced to Inkmill under an annual contract, renewing each March. They handle sanitization and PDF export; we own the upload queue. SLA: 4-hour response on rendering failures. Escalate only after two failed retries. Their support desk is reachable at the address below.

billing contact of hahaf-baguf = zorael.tammir.jorius@sivrelhq.internal

**Q: How does Brindlepost retry failed webhook deliveries?**

A: Retries use exponential backoff: five attempts over roughly one hour. A 2xx response stops retries; anything else counts as failure. Duplicate deliveries are possible — endpoints must be idempotent. Support can manually replay from the delivery log. Replay console access requires the recovery passphrase listed below.

vault phrase of bagaf-kajeg = jorath-feniel-briir-siliel-ralix

## Data Stores — Token Refresh Bug

Plugin authors: the Larkfen session service currently fails to rotate refresh tokens when a plugin holds a stale handle. Workaround is to re-authenticate on 401 rather than retrying. To inspect affected session rows yourself on the sandbox store, connect with the following string.

replica DSN, kajep-yahag: mssql://praok_svc:iF@db-8d68.plorvaio.local:5432/eliion

TURN-208: Gatevale turnstile counters at the Merrow Field pilot double-count when a rotation reverses mid-cycle. Attendance totals drift roughly 2% high per event. The debounce window fix is implemented, reviewed by Ilsa, and soak-tested across two simulated match days without drift. Ready for your cut; the candidate build is identified below.

trace token, tagag-tafog: htk6_5ed18c

## Socketry Environments — Compression Notes

Quick context for your review: we enable per-message deflate in staging but keep it off on the public prod endpoint, mostly over compression-oracle concerns with attacker-influenced payloads. Internal prod traffic gets it since payloads there aren't attacker-controlled. Bandwidth savings are real (~60%) but so is the risk, hence the split. Current compression settings per environment are below.

settings of kawig-kahip:
ULAETH_PIN=4988
ULAETH_TENANT=briath
ULAETH_METRICS_HOST=metrics.ulaeth.xolmarworks.test
ULAETH_SEAL=seal_e1a2fe42
ULAETH_STANDBY_TEAM=pelix